What's Next for the Marvel Cinematic Universe
Zoe Saldana as Gamora, Chris Hemsworth as Thor, and Brie Larson as Carol Danvers star in Phase 4 of the Marvel Cinematic Universe. Credit - Alamy (3)
Marvel is still breaking records at the box office: last year’s Spider-Man: No Way Home had the second-highest grossing opening weekend ever, despite debuting during the Omicron surge in December 2021.
But it’s getting hard to keep up with everything that’s going on—and I’m not just talking about keeping track of multiple Spider-Men. Now, to understand the plot nuances in each film, you have to catch up on all the TV shows. The details of the Disney+ series WandaVision will inform the plot of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ness. The events of the series Loki are setting the stage for Ant-Man and the Wasp: Quantumania. And it’s only getting bigger. Kevin Feige told a crowd at CinemaCon on Wednesday that the folks at Marvel Studios were convening for a creative retreat where they will lay out the next decade of Marvel movies.
Here are all the movies and TV shows set to debut in the Marvel Cinematic Universe over the next several years.
Moon Knight
When to Watch
March 30, 2022 on Disney+
What We Know About the Plot
Moon Knight is already well underway. Oscar Isaac plays Marc Spector, a character with dissociative identity disorder. One of his personalities works at a gift shop at a British museum. But another is ex-military. Spector also wields the power of the Egyptian god of the moon, Khonshu, and can turn into a superhero (sort of) at will. Marc squares off against a cult-like figure played by Ethan Hawke who decides whether his acolytes live or die based on the movements of the scales of justice that he has tattooed on his arm.
Which MCU Characters Are Set to Appear
So far, no other superheroes have popped up in Moon Knight. It seems, for now at least, to be its own contained story.

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ness
When to Watch
May 6, 2022 in theaters
What We Know About the Plot
Sam Raimi, the director of the original, iconic Spider-Man trilogy, is returning to superhero fare with the Doctor Strange sequel. Doctor Strange (Benedict Cumberbatch) struggles with the fracturing of the multiverse and the chaos that comes with it. He’s aided by Wong (Benedict Wong), the head of the Sanctum Sanctorum, and Xochitl Gomez (from The Baby-Sitters Club), who makes her MCU debut as the superhero America Chavez, the first openly queer Latinx character to headline her own comic book series. Chiwetel Ejiofor returns as Mordo. Last we saw Mordo, he had decided there were too many magic-wielders in the world and is on a mission to cull that group. But the real Big Bad seems to be Scarlet Witch (Elizabeth Olsen). More on her below.
Which MCU Characters Are Set to Appear
Wanda Maximoff, who in the show WandaVision leveled up her powers and took on the persona of Scarlet Witch, will play a major role in this film. As she tells Doctor Strange in the trailer, when he breaks the rules, the world calls him a hero. But when she does, she’s cast as the villain: “That doesn’t seem fair.” Wanda will presumably be on a mission to find her twin sons, whom she created with her magic in WandaVision but disappeared at the end of the show.
The trailers also revealed that Patrick Stewart will be reprising his roles as Professor X from the X-Men movies. He sits on a council called the Illuminati that presumably draws its numbers from many different dimensions. Most likely, this is how Disney will introduce the X-Men (characters they newly acquired when they merged with 20th Century Fox) to the MCU. Rumors are swirling that John Krasinski will play another Illuminati member, Mr. Fantastic from the Fantastic Four. And some keen-eyed fans have spotted the shield of Captain Carter (an alternate universe version of Captain America’s love interest Peggy Carter who takes the super-soldier serum). It’s possible Hayley Atwell, who played Peggy Carter in the first Captain America movie and her own television series on ABC, will pop up in the movie as well.
This is a multiverse story, so we can expect lots of variants of these main characters and even some cameos. We already know from the trailers we’ll meet an inter-dimensional space octopus that played an important role in the Disney+ animated TV series What If…?; a zombie version of Wanda (also from What If…?); and an evil version of Doctor Strange.

Black Panther: Wakanda Forever
When to Watch
November 11, 2022 in theaters
What We Know About the Plot
Director and co-writer Ryan Coogler—who helmed the first, historic Black Panther—has remain tight-lipped about Wakanda Forever. Marvel Studios has to re-write and re-conceive the sequel after the tragic passing of star Chadwick Boseman. Marvel Studios head Kevin Feige has been emphatic about the fact that the studio will not recast Boseman’s role of T’Challa and has said the movie will focus on the ensemble that supported Boseman in the original film. That group includes a power house of talent, including Lupita Nyong’o as Nakia, Daniel Kaluuya as W’Kabi, Angela Bassett as Ramonda, Danai Gurira as Okoye, Winston Duke as M’Baku, Letitia Wright as Shuri, and Martin Freeman as Everett Ross. I May Destroy You’s Michael Coel is also joining the ensemble as a character Marvel has yet to reveal, and Tenoch Huerta has been cast as the antagonist Namor the Sub-Mariner, an Aquaman-like figure in the Marvel comics.
Which MCU Characters Are Set to Appear
Dominique Thorne (Judas and the Black Messiah) will debut the role of Riri Williams before she stars in her own Disney+ series Iron Heart, about a young woman who builds her own Iron Man suit.

Ant-Man and the Wasp: Quantumania
When to Watch
July 28 2023 in Theaters
What We Know About the Plot
Ant-Man (Paul Rudd) and The Wasp (Evangeline Lilly) just cannot tear themselves away from the Quantum Realm. First, they went sub-atomic to travel into the realm as rescue The Wasp’s mother, played by Michelle Pfeiffer. Then, Ant-Man got trapped in the realm for years, and yet returned again as part of the Avengers’ time travel shenanigans in Endgame. One might think after getting stuck down there so many times and losing so many years, this family may have had enough of the Quantum Realm, but you would be wrong.
Which MCU Characters Are Set to Appear
Plot details are scarce but Marvel has confirmed that Jonathan Majors, who made his Marvel debut in the TV show Loki, will play the villain in Quantumania. In Loki, Majors played a character named He Who Remains who ensured that there was a single, stable timeline. He’s killed at the end of the show, sending the multiverse into chaos and creating branching timelines from the single “main” timeline. He Who Remains has many different variants, some more evil than others. The one who is set to be introduced in Quantumania is named Kang the Conquerer, a villain who wants to conquer all the branching timelines.

Loki, Season 2
When to Watch
TBA on Disney+
What We Know About the Plot
The first season of Loki introduced the concept of “variants,” different versions of a single character that live in parallel universes. Loki met a child version of himself, an alligator version of himself, and a female version of himself, among many other variants. He fell for the female version of himself, who goes by Sylvie—which is a very egotistical, Loki thing to do. By the end of the show, Loki and Sylvie discover a man called He Who Remains. This man maintains one universal timeline, called “The Sacred Timeline,” to prevent multiversal chaos. But to maintain order, he kills off some variants who deviate from the “sacred” path. Sylvie kills He Who Remains, and in doing so releases the variants of He Who Remains, one of whom is a very smart, very evil variant called Kang the Conquerer. Loki wakes up in a universe where Kang the Conquerer rules over everyone. Kang is set to appear in Ant-Man and the Wasp: Quantumania, so presumably Loki, Season 2 will tie into that movie in some way.
Which MCU Characters Are Set to Appear
Besides Kang, it’s unclear. But now that the multiverse has split, anything is possible. Loki could be reunited with Thor or even his murdered mother again.
